About the Role
We are looking for a skilled Automation Engineer to design, develop, and maintain scalable automation solutions that improve operational efficiency within a managed services environment. This role is ideal for someone with strong scripting expertise, hands-on experience with RMM and RPA platforms, and a solid understanding of IT operations and automation best practices.
You will work closely with infrastructure, service desk, and engineering teams to streamline workflows, automate repetitive tasks, and enhance operational performance across a range of systems and platforms.
About the Client
You will be working with a technology-driven managed services organisation focused on delivering innovative IT solutions and operational excellence. The business is committed to leveraging automation, integration, and modern technologies to improve service delivery, optimise internal processes, and enhance customer outcomes.
The team operates within a collaborative and fast-paced environment that values continuous improvement, technical innovation, and proactive problem-solving.
Ideal Profile
- Strong proficiency in PowerShell, Python, Jinja, and Bash scripting
- Hands-on experience designing and maintaining automation workflows using RPA platforms such as Rewst or similar tools
- Experience working within RMM environments such as Datto RMM or equivalent platforms
- Solid understanding of REST APIs, system integrations, and JSON data handling
- Experience working with Git for version control and collaboration
- Knowledge of web and email technologies including HTML, CSS, and JavaScript
- Previous experience within MSP, Helpdesk, Service Desk, or IT infrastructure environments
- Strong understanding of MSP operations, workflows, and common operational challenges
- Experience automating service desk processes, infrastructure management, and operational workflows
- Familiarity with Microsoft 365, Azure, and MSP tools such as ConnectWise or Autotask is highly desirable
- Strong documentation and communication skills
- Ability to collaborate effectively with cross-functional technical teams
- Proactive approach to identifying automation opportunities and process improvements
- Ability to balance operational priorities while maintaining high-quality delivery standards
- Analytical and solutions-focused mindset
- Strong attention to detail and commitment to reliability
- Continuous improvement mindset with a focus on scalability and efficiency
- Security-conscious approach to automation and integrations
Technical Skills & Experience
MSP & Infrastructure Knowledge
Communication & Collaboration
Personal Attributes
Responsibilities
- Design, develop, and maintain automation workflows using scripting and RPA platforms
- Build reusable automation modules to support IT operations and service delivery
- Develop and maintain scripts using PowerShell, Python, Jinja, and Bash
- Work with JSON and structured data to support scalable automation solutions
- Develop automation solutions within RMM environments such as Datto RMM or similar platforms
- Automate operational MSP tasks including user provisioning, ticketing workflows, device management, monitoring, and alert remediation
- Support and optimise service desk and infrastructure operations through automation initiatives
- Build and maintain integrations using REST APIs across systems and platforms
- Work with API documentation including OpenAPI and Swagger specifications
- Integrate automation solutions with Microsoft 365, Azure, and other MSP technologies
- Use Git for version control and collaborative development practices
- Maintain clear documentation for automation workflows, scripts, and integrations
- Work closely with service desk, infrastructure, and engineering teams to identify automation opportunities and deliver scalable solutions
- Identify repetitive manual tasks and implement automation to improve operational efficiency
- Continuously optimise workflows for performance, scalability, and reliability
- Apply security-first principles across all automation processes and integrations
Automation Development
RMM & MSP Automation
API & Integration
Development & Collaboration
Continuous Improvement & Security
How we take care of our team
π° Get paid in Australian Dollars
π₯ Medical insurance from day one for you + spouse (or parents if unmarried)
π©Ί Generous OPD coverage from doctor visits to all your medical needs
π‘ Home office setup allowance to build your ideal workspace
π Internet allowance to keep you connected
πͺ Gym & wellness allowance to stay fit and balanced
π Work hard, play hard β regular team events & engagement activities
π§ Diji Assist β Mental health & counseling support when you need it
π We invest in you β reimbursement for industry certifications
π£οΈ Open-door culture β your ideas and feedback always matter
π Flexible work β home or office, wherever you do your best work
π Rewards & recognition that actually recognize you
π₯³ Great christmas & financial year-end parties to unwind with your loved ones
